Teachers, Administrator of the Year recognized at January School Board Meeting

TEACHERS AND ADMINISTRATOR OF THE YEAR- The 2019-2020 Teachers of the year and Administrator of the Year were recognized at the Lawrence County School District Board Meeting held January 21. Pictured from left are Superintendent of Education Dr. Titus Hines, New Hebron Attendance Center Teacher of the Year Mrs. LeeAnn Stewart, Topeka-Tilton Attendance Center Teacher of the Year Mrs. Clancie Daley, Lawrence County High School Teacher of the Year Mr. Delton Eubanks, Lawrence County School District Administrator of the Year Mr. Cedric Collins, Rod Paige Middle School Teacher of the Year Mrs. Carla Bell, Monticello Elementary School Teacher of the Year Mrs. Wendy Dean, and Lawrence County Technical/Career Center Teacher of the Year Mrs. Roshanda Alexander. Rod Paige’s Mrs. Carla Bell was also recognized as Lawrence County School District Teacher of the Year. Bell and Collins will be recognized at the Teacher of the Year/Administrator of the Year Awards Luncheon, hosted by Mississippi Department of Education in April. 

Teachers of the Year for each school in the district, the Lawrence County School District Teacher of the Year, and the Lawrence County School District Administrator of the Year were recognized at the January School Board meeting held January 21. They are pictured above with Superintendent of Education Dr. Titus Hines. Congratulations to each of these and thank you for your dedication to quality education.
In Dr. Hines’s first meeting as Superintendent, many additional items of interest were discussed and approved. Board Officers for the year were elected as follows: Dr. Wesley Bridges, President;
Dr. Mark Herbert, Vice-President; and Curtis Alexander, Secretary. These are the same officers who served in these positions last year.
The School Board will hold their regular February meeting, Thursday, February 20, at 5:30 p.m. at the district office.
